South Africans were floored when Ithuba announced that a lucky South African won more than R120 million. The woman revealed herself as the winner, and she got candid about how difficult life was before winning.
A woman from Gauteng used the ABSA banking app and placed a R37.50 bet with her manually selected Lotto numbers. The lady's fortune made headlines as the National Lottery searched for the winner, and at that time, she was ignoring unfamiliar phone numbers, thinking they were telemarketers. The woman said she finally picked up when the phone rang on 8 August 2025, and the bank told her she had to report to the nearest Ithuba office to claim her winnings. She only found out that she won the jackpot at the National Lottery offices, and she shared, "I am still in shock."

The Lotto winnings came at the right time as she and her husband only relied on her income following years of his unemployment. She described their finances as a "tough hand-to-mouth situation." Following the lotto win, she is hopeful, saying, "Now, everything will change."

What will Lotto R124M jackpot winner do with money?
The woman said the R124 million would help her rebuild her house as well as own a car. The CEO of Ithuba, Charmaine Mabuza, said the organisation was touched by the way the jackpot changed the woman's life. She said the Gauteng lotto winner was a testament to the National Lottery's mission to give average South Africans the opportunity to achieve their wildest dreams.
